Culture Shift: Teaching in a Learner-Centered Environment Powered by Digital Learning. Alliance for Excellent Education, May 2012. Pp. 1-16 on learner centered education and teaching in a learner-centered environment.

The Culture Builder by Roland S. Barth. Educational Leadership, Volume 59, Number 8, May 2002, Pages 6-11. An insightful overview of the importance and challenges of changing a school culture. Not directly about digital learning, but applies to the larger issue of creating a school culture that supports innovation and fosters learning by all.

Serious Challenges Facing District Leaders. This infographic and the following text from the Alliance for Excellent Education provides an overview of the challenges and the elements that leaders must address in responding to the challenges.

1:1 Model Research: National and State Perspectives. Jenifer O. Corn, Friday Institute for Educational Innovation, March 2013 provides a brief summary of the relevant research.
